# HG changeset patch # User Jaroslav Tulach # Date 1358889112 -3600 # Node ID 715a6c77b19e8956cd33866569c1d3a953ff82f0 # Parent b5150a06c5d1d0f175232d85134a75d5e43760d5 Using canvas in the sample application diff -r b5150a06c5d1 -r 715a6c77b19e mojo/src/main/resources/archetype-resources/src/main/java/App.java --- a/mojo/src/main/resources/archetype-resources/src/main/java/App.java Tue Jan 22 21:59:13 2013 +0100 +++ b/mojo/src/main/resources/archetype-resources/src/main/java/App.java Tue Jan 22 22:11:52 2013 +0100 @@ -21,7 +21,10 @@ @On(event = CLICK, id="hello") static void hello(Index m) { - Element.alert(m.getHelloMessage()); + GraphicsContext g = m.CANVAS.getContext(); + g.clearRect(0, 0, 1000, 1000); + g.setFont("italic 40px Calibri"); + g.fillText(m.getHelloMessage(), 10, 40); } @ComputedProperty diff -r b5150a06c5d1 -r 715a6c77b19e mojo/src/main/resources/archetype-resources/src/main/resources/index.xhtml --- a/mojo/src/main/resources/archetype-resources/src/main/resources/index.xhtml Tue Jan 22 21:59:13 2013 +0100 +++ b/mojo/src/main/resources/archetype-resources/src/main/resources/index.xhtml Tue Jan 22 22:11:52 2013 +0100 @@ -8,6 +8,10 @@

Loading Bck2Brwsr's Hello World...

Your name: +

+ + +